Fishing rod detail

A Fishing rod is an item used to catch fish through the Fishing skill. It can be bought from Gerrant's Fishy Business in Port Sarim, Harry's Fishing Shop in Catherby, Hank's Fishing Shop in Lumbridge, or the Grand Exchange for 523 coins.

In order to fish, players must have fishing bait in their inventory and at least one inventory slot to hold a fish (more inventory slots for more fishes), for every fish except Rocktail. To catch Rocktail you will need Living Minerals instead of fishing bait. It was once possible to lose your rod from random events, but after the 25 February 2009 updates, it is now impossible for this to happen. Free players can use it to catch Sardines, Herrings, and Pikes. Members can use Blamish snail slime on it to turn it into an Oily fishing rod. The Oily fishing rod can only be used to catch Lava Eels.

Using this type of rod, you can catch:

Image Fish Level Members
File:Raw sardine.PNG File:Sardine.PNG Sardine 5 No
File:Raw Herring.PNG File:Herring.PNG Herring 10 No
File:Raw pike.PNG File:Pike.PNG Pike 25 No
File:Raw slimey eel.PNG File:Cookedslimyeel.PNG Slimy Eel 28 Yes
File:Raw cave eel.PNG File:Cookedcaveeel.PNG Cave Eel 38 Yes
CavefishRaw cavefish Cavefish 85 Yes
File:Raw Rocktail.PNG Rocktail Rocktail 90 Yes

Glitch

File:FishingRodGlitch.png

The glitch. Usually it's fixed.

If you do the Home Teleport Spell, then use the Explore Emote while about 5 or more spaces away, then click on the Bait Fishing Spot, you will have the Fishing Rod out, then glide over to the spot, then start fishing.

Template:WP alsoThere is also another glitch which can only be seen at certain angles where the fishing rod appears to be under the water (water texture).
